Location
Baltonsborough is an attractive Somerset village surrounded by beautiful open countryside. The village is well served by a primary school, public house, local store and village hall. The parish hosts many clubs and activities. Glastonbury, Street and Shepton Mallet are all within easy reach and offer a further range of shopping, dining and leisure pursuits. Street is home to the Clarks Village outlet shopping and of course the Millfield School Campus with Edgarley School at Glastonbury. The nearest M5 motorway interchange at Dunball (Junction 23) is some thirty minutes drive whilst Bristol, Bath and Yeovil are all within daily commuting distance. Castle Cary, with its main line station to London Paddington, and the A303 major trunk road at Podimore, are both approximately 8 miles.
